詳解VS Emulator for Android,微軟的Mobile First!
今天的微博、Hacker News 以及各大 IT 媒體網站基本都被微軟公布 .NET 開源計劃霸占了。下一代 .NET 開發框架,即 .NET 2015,從 ASP.NET 5 至 Common Language Runtime 和 Base Class Libraries,整個服務器開發環境都將通過 Github 開源,實現跨平臺支持 Mac OS X 和 Linux。除此之外,集成 Clang 和 LLVM 并自帶 Android 模擬器的 Visual Studio 2015 也著實讓人大為驚喜,因為這意味著,開發者們可以使用 Visual Studio 來開發 iOS 和 Android 應用。
目前,包含 Visual Studio Emulator for Android Preview 的 Visual Studio 2015 Preview 已開放下載。而在 MSDN Blog 中,微軟也對 Visual Studio Emulator for Android 進行了詳細的介紹,當開發者對 Android 開發選項做出任一選擇時,Visual Studio 便會自動安裝全新的 Visual Studio Emulator for Android 來調試應用。
通過 Visual Studio 2015 Preview,開發者無論選擇 JavaScript(或 TypeScript)、C++或 C# 哪種編程模型,都可直接“編輯-編譯-調試”Android 應用。在開始調試前,開發者必須選擇目標設備或模擬器,如果想從另外的 IDE 中調用 VS Emulator for Android,可選擇任一部署選項,然后關閉項目留下模擬器即能實現對其他 IDE 的支持。
Visual Studio Emulator for Android 主要功能:
- 模擬傳感器:除了將模擬器作為部署目標之外,開發者還可以充分利用其中的傳感器模擬等功能。
- 縮放:使用“Zoom”,開發者可更改模擬器大小,而通過“Fit to Screen”,則可以完美適配不同目標設備屏幕。
- 旋轉:支持左/右旋轉,且模擬器大小不變。
- 網絡狀態:無需配置,可重用主機設備網絡連接。
- GPS 定位:支持涉及導航、地理圍墻、步行/騎行/駕駛等的應用模擬設置。
- 除上述之外,還包括加速度計、電源模擬、內置截圖工具、拖放安裝 APK、SD 卡等功能。點擊鏈接,查看更多 VS Android 模擬器特性及詳情。
內容來源:Android Police、MSDN Blog
<span id="shareA4" class="fl">
</span>